Amport and District adds an Irizar i6S Efficient integral

routeone Team
Published: 12 May 2023
Share
SHARE

Amport and District Coaches of Weyhill near Andover has taken delivery of a PSVAR compliant Irizar i6S Efficient integral, supplied by Irizar UK.

It is a 12.9m long example that carries 53 passengers. Three-point belts, USB charging points, magazine nets, footrests and drop-down tables are part of the specification along with a centre sunken toilet, audio/visual entertainment with two monitors, and a drinks machine supplied and fitted by AD Coach Systems.

Accessibility comes thanks to a Masats lift immediately behind the front axle. It is complemented by Hanover destination displays, while the driver benefits from a rear-view camera system in lieu of traditional mirrors.

The coach is powered by the DAF MX-11 engine developing 408bhp coupled to a ZF EcoLife automatic gearbox.
